Description

Nos 49 to 54 on Little Horton Green, built around 1800 to 1830, is a three-storey block of tenements designed as "back to backs." The rear pair appears to have been constructed slightly later than the front. The building is made of sandstone "brick" with ashlar quoins and features stone slate roofs with coped gable ends and shaped kneelers, along with corniced chimneys. All floors have three-light square mullion windows set in squared surrounds. The doorways have plain squared jambs, with paired entrances for Nos 52 and 53, featuring six-panel doors and rectangular fanlights. Some of the "back to backs" have been combined into a single property.
